STORY:

“Diatribes” is a poetic VR interactive narrative that explores the internal conflicts surrounding climate change. In a 15-20 minute experience, players navigate a surreal mindspace filled with distractions and emotional turmoil. This dynamic world transforms based on your emotional state—sometimes inviting contemplation through meditative tasks, while at other times thrusting you into a high-stakes gauntlet between Nature and Civilization.

As you journey through diverse landscapes, you’ll unlock ancient myths and receive guidance from a therapeutic companion. The experience intertwines personal reflection with broader climate issues, encouraging players to confront their anxieties and envision a hopeful future.

PROJECT HISTORY:

Inspiration for “Diatribes” came from the ecological philosopher Timothy Morton's description of climate change as a “hyperobject” — a thing so massively distributed that you can’t see it in its entirety, but you can conceive it. To represent a concept like this we looked to surrealism, an artistic movement that is effective in depicting the unnerving, illogical scenes that surround us. The climate crisis is increasingly present in our daily lives, but understanding its enormity is still confusing for many, often triggering strong emotions that undermine constructive conversations. We hope this VR experience will encourage people to move towards open dialogue about our anxieties and make a space for people to discuss what is needed to take action towards a healthier future for the planet.

The first demo was completed in 2019 for the HTC VIVE through a New Media fellowship grant from Kala Art Institute. A vertical slice of the game world was completed in early 2022 for the Oculus Quest 1 while we participated in the Oculus Launch Pad program. The final version is an interactive 6 DOF game, made for the Quest 2 and 3 and was funded by Meta’s Oculus Launch Pad Grant. It is a single player experience that can be played standing or sitting. The player must complete tasks and navigate the surroundings to move the story forward.
